Basic SM management tool with hiccups

I bought Heropost because of the lifetime deal for just under €170. I was looking for an inexpensive social media management platform to manage my own profiles as well as customer profiles. The competition is just absurdly expensive for small businesses like me and the lifetime deal was extremely attractive to me.

I have been using Heropost for about 2-3 months now. Heropost is rather rudimentary and I have the feeling that it still has a lot of hiccups and hang-ups. Basically, most things work quite well. Posts on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, Google My Business, Pinterest etc. can be scheduled easily and are posted reliably.

But... only as long as only to basic stuff.

You can't pair a business profile on Pinterest. I mean... Of course I want to pair a business profile. Sucks!

On Instagram, I can't create portrait carousel posts.

On LinkedIn, I can't post a PDF.

Error messages, e.g. because the character limit was exceeded, are displayed in cryptic messages where you first have to search where the problem is.

Support responds quickly provided they are around. Good luck on the weekend or when everyone is still asleep due to the time delay...

Hashtags cannot be looked up by language/region, which makes it difficult to find what you are looking for.

Moreover, the platform – espexcially the integrated analytics – is horribly slow (loading times of 5-20 seconds and more) or you just get an error message because something went wrong. With Pinterest, somehow only individual boards are tracked, but not the entire profile. All in all, pretty pointless for my needs.

There is no way to add more users and give them access only to certain profiles.

It goes on. Again, it's a rip-off, you get a basic SM management solution. But as I said, it's basic. If you have professional needs and SM is an income source for you, I'd suggest you have a look at some of the more established solutions out there.

I have to say, I am positively surprised by Biolinks. This was also included free of charge and works great!

All in all, an OK SM management tool and considering the price tag of 170 € I'd probably buy it again, because it does help me save time and in the long run, it's pretty cheap. It is much cheaper than the competition and you pay only once; but you get only a half-finished product, of which I have not noticed any improvements / updates since the purchase. Hopefully, the further development will continue and the current status quo will not be stuck forever.

In no case would I advise anyone to pay the regular price of currently 500 and 1000 for 6 months and 12 months respectively. Maybe Heropost develops further and finally becomes a real rival, but right now it's not.

Heropost.io, Sure, Great Lifetime Price Deal. But, Nah, Not Really Worth It

Heropost.io

Cons
Can’t post stories (for IG at least)

It can’t handle uploading more than 60 seconds no matter what it may say about IGTV - It may be indicating you can pre-record a session and PRESENT it as live. Can’t say I understand the point, or how it would work? Since it stalls out trying to process more than 55 seconds.

Their support is not 24X7 (in all fairness, can’t recall if it claimed to be though)

Good luck trying to cancel. No options in dashboard, can’t reach support and googling the term refund from heropost.io in google does not even yield a result!

Pros
Does streamline multiple accounts - could be less clunky but still does achieve the basics damn well

Covers a damn high amount of profiles/platforms

Lots of platforms you’ve (most likely) never heard of to try to gain some momentum

Closing Thoughts: It’s cool. It also mimics the features accessible to you in Facebook business center. In my opinion, use that for IG and FB. Twitter is actually easy enough from a desktop that it’s silly to pay for anything like Tweetdeck or else-wise (again, just my opinion). It doesn’t really process YouTube stuff that great, so just keep doing that how you always have been. I’m trying to get my money back, but who knows - You may like it! I think the cons outweigh here though - just my take !

Update since writing: Be wary of their BS 15 day return policy. I just had surgery and am slightly over this mark, needing the money for medical bills but they don't particularly care, so there's that.
